On the impact of anisotropy on dispersion spectra of acoustic waves in plates

A brief overview is given of specific features that can (or cannot) appear in the dispersion spectra of traction-free elastic homogeneous plates due to anisotropy. Its effect on the overall spectral configuration and on the short and long wave trends is illuminated with a link to anisotropic traits of bulk and surface waves. Relevant classical and recent results are put together, and new points are established.
